What is the average salary in Highland Park, IL?
Highland Park, IL offers a variety of job opportunities with competitive salaries. The average yearly salary in the area is $59,004. This figure reflects a range of industries and positions available to job seekers. The salary distribution shows that most people earn between $30,500 and $167,500 annually.
The salary distribution in Highland Park, IL includes:
- 37.96% earn between $30,500 and $42,955
- 16.58% earn between $42,955 and $55,409
- 8.93% earn between $55,409 and $67,864
- 10.25% earn between $67,864 and $80,318
- 11.43% earn between $80,318 and $92,773
- 4.50% earn between $92,773 and $105,227
- 2.20% earn between $105,227 and $117,682
- 1.54% earn between $117,682 and $130,136
- 0.76% earn between $130,136 and $142,591
- 0.46% earn between $142,591 and $155,045
- 0.39% earn between $155,045 and $167,500

How does the cost of living in Highland Park, IL compare to the national average?

Highland Park, IL, has a higher cost of living compared to the nationwide average, which is set at 100. The housing index in Highland Park stands at 195, indicating a significant increase of 95% over the national average. This suggests that housing costs in Highland Park are nearly double what they are on average across the country.
Other aspects of living in Highland Park also show higher costs. For example, groceries cost 12% more, with an index of 112. Utilities are 10% higher, at 110, while transportation costs are 25% above the national average, with an index of 125. Healthcare costs are slightly below the national average, with an index of 103, showing a 3% decrease. Miscellaneous expenses are 15% higher, with an index of 115. Overall, these figures highlight that living in Highland Park involves higher expenses in most areas compared to the national average.
